The House of Living Heritage in Šmarješke Toplice offers visitors a rich and interactive journey through the cultural and natural history of this picturesque region in southeastern Slovenia. Set amid rolling vineyards, meadows, and forests, the center serves as an intergenerational hub for exploring the traditions, skills, and stories that have shaped local life from prehistoric times to the present.

The main exhibition, “From Nature to the Future,” guides guests through the daily lives of past and present inhabitants, with a special focus on winemaking and culinary heritage. Visitors can watch a presentation film in the Zwittro Hall, named after local historian Fran Zwittro, and discover the central figure of the orant—a symbol of liberation and the enduring importance of heritage. The facility also features a modern enological laboratory, where the art and science of wine production are brought to life.

Hands-on experiences are a highlight at the House of Living Heritage. The Room of Living Heritage hosts culinary workshops, inviting guests to try their hand at traditional recipes, while the Creativity Room offers ethnological activities and rotating exhibitions. The Land of Archaeology section delves into the region’s ancient roots, displaying artifacts and stories from prehistoric and historical times.

Whether you’re interested in food, history, or local traditions, the House of Living Heritage provides a welcoming and educational stop in Šmarješke Toplice, connecting visitors to the vibrant spirit of the Dolenjska region.
